Select Projects

Site Ecological Risk Assessments:  Conducted ecological risk assessments at numerous US and international contaminated sites.

Ecological Injury Assessment and Causation Analysis:  Conducted ecological injury assessments and causation analyses for ecological receptors exposed to a variety of chemical and non-chemical stressors at different sites.

Environmental Stewardship:  For global companies, evaluated the environmental safety of their products to support sustainability goals.

Pharmaceutical Environmental Risk Assessments:  For pharmaceutical companies, evaluated the environmental risk of their new drugs to support market approval, compliant with either European (European Medicines Agency [EMA]) or US (Food and Drug Administration [US FDA]) guidelines.  As part of several assessments, oversaw the collection of additional environmental fate and toxicity test data.

Emerging Contaminants:  In the context of a wide variety of projects, provided consulting and expert support related to the environmental safety of various contaminants of emerging concern, such as endocrine disruptors, pharmaceuticals, 1,4-dioxane, PFAS, microplastics, etc.

Endocrine Disruptors:  For companies, trade associations, and government (US EPA), provided technical expertise related to the topic of endocrine disruption.
